Core Features and Technical Specifications
At the heart of this system lies the brushless motor controller, engineered to deliver stable power conversion while minimising energy loss. Its aluminium casing is ribbed for enhanced thermal dissipation, a critical feature noted by users who prioritise durability in demanding conditions. The grooves along the housing facilitate airflow, ensuring internal components remain within optimal temperature ranges even during prolonged use. This design choice addresses a common concern among riders—overheating during steep climbs or extended journeys—resulting in a product that consistently maintains performance without compromising longevity.
The inclusion of an LCD 866 display adds a layer of intuitiveness to the setup. Riders appreciate the backlit screen, which provides clear visibility of metrics such as speed, battery level, and distance travelled, even in low-light environments. A standout feature mentioned in user feedback is the quick-adjust button, allowing seamless transitions between assist modes without requiring the rider to divert attention from the road. The display’s compatibility with 22.2mm handlebars ensures straightforward installation across most bicycle models, eliminating the need for custom brackets or modifications.
Versatility and Compatibility
One of the most lauded aspects of this kit is its broad compatibility. Designed to accommodate both 36V and 48V systems, it serves as a universal upgrade for mid-range and high-power e-bikes. Users operating 500W motors report smooth acceleration and responsive torque, while those with 750W configurations highlight the controller’s ability to handle increased load without voltage drop-offs. The integrated light control switch and dedicated lighting port further enhance its utility, enabling riders to connect auxiliary lights directly to the system—a practical addition for commuters or off-road enthusiasts.
The kit’s plug-and-play design simplifies installation, with pre-configured connectors reducing the risk of wiring errors. Riders with intermediate technical skills have noted that the process requires minimal tools, though adherence to the provided schematic is advised for optimal results. The lightweight construction (472g) ensures that the system does not add significant bulk, preserving the bicycle’s agility.

Considerations for Potential Users
While the kit excels in versatility, riders should verify compatibility with their specific motor type and voltage before installation. Some users suggested pairing the controller with a high-discharge battery to fully exploit its 22A current capacity, particularly for off-road applications. Additionally, the LCD display’s mounting bracket, though adjustable, may require minor modifications for non-standard handlebar diameters.
